    64, DARFIELD ROAD, LONDON, SE4 1ER

    This terraced leasehold property on Darfield Road last sold in October 2024 for £350,000. Based on price growth in the SE4 district since then, its estimated current value is £354,731 — placing it in the 60th percentile nationally and the 12th percentile within SE4. The property covers 47 m² (506 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£7,547 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.
